Creating a batch scheduling task for Auto Assignment
A batch scheduling task can be added to the job scheduler to generate schedules with Auto-Assignment on a recurring basis.
- Select Maintenance > System Administration > Job Scheduler.
- Click Add Schedule.
- Specify a name for the task in the Task Description field.
- In the Task Type section, select Java Task and then select BatchGenerateSchedulesWithAutoAssignment from the drop down.
-
In the Scheduled Time section, specify this
information:
- Run at
- Specify the time to run the task.
- Timezone
- Select the applicable time zone using the look up. By default, the Timezone field displays your actual local time zone.
-
In the Scheduling Time section, select one of these
options:
- Once to schedule the task to run only once.
- Weekly to schedule the task to run by day of the week.
- Monthly to schedule the task to run by month and day of month.
- If you selected Weekly, select the check boxes to indicate on which days of the week to run the task.
-
If you selected Monthly, use one of
these options:
- Select the Day Of option and specify the day of month to run the task.
- Select the Of option and specify the week of the month and day of the week to indicate which day the task runs. For example, you can select Second and Thursday to run the task on the second Thursday of each month.
- Select the check boxes to indicate which months of the year the task runs.
-
In the Scheduling Range section, specify this
information:
- Start On
- Select the date that you want the task to begin executing.
- End By
- Specify the end date of the task, or leave the field blank to schedule the task indefinitely.
-
Configure any additional options for the task as required.
See the "Job Scheduler" chapter in the Infor Workforce Management Time and Attendance Implementation and Administration Guide.
- Click Submit and click OK on the confirmation prompt.
- For your batch scheduling task, click Parameters.
-
Specify this information:
- Location
- Select the location to generate the schedule for. Schedules are generated for the location and its child locations.
- Schedule Name
- Specify the name to be applied to the generated schedules. Optionally, you can include the characters %FW in the name to add the fiscal week number in the schedule names. This can help users to differentiate between schedules that are generated for different weeks.
- Min Day Offset to Start Date
- Specify the minimum number of days between the batch execution date and the schedule start date. When the batch job runs, the offset number is added to the current date to calculate the offset date. If the offset date is the same day of the week as the start day configured for the location, the schedule starts on the offset date. Otherwise, the schedule starts on the next occurrence of the start day after the offset date.
- Delete Existing
- Select this check box to delete existing schedules before creating the new schedules. This deletes any schedules created for the location(s) that overlap the dates of the new schedules. Clear this check box to skip schedule generation for any locations that have existing schedules that overlap the new schedules.
- Batch Process Size
- Specify the number of schedules that can be generated
simultaneously by this task. The number of schedules must be the
same or lower than the total number of Dash licenses available.
Schedules beyond this number are queued until other schedules are
completed.
See "Dash Licenses and Parallel Schedule Generation" in the Infor Workforce Management Installation and Configuration Guide for details.
- Solution Time Out (In Seconds)
- Specify the number of seconds before the search for an optimal solution times
out.Note: The default value is 3600 seconds (60 minutes). We recommend you set this value to 300 - 420 seconds (five to seven minutes).
- Solution Optimality Tolerance (In Percentage)
- Specify the margin of error that is allowed when searching for an optimal solution. The lower the margin of error, the better the results will be.
- Workmail Notification
- Select users to be notified via Workmail when the task is completed.
- Click Submit to save the task parameters and click OK in the confirmation prompt.